Olubadan: Ibadan begins 21-day mourning for late Oba Olakulehin

•Olubadan of Ibadan, Oba Owolabi Olakulehin

A 21-day mourning period has been declared in Ibadan to honour the passing of the 43rd Olubadan of Ibadanland, Oba Owolabi Olakulehin, who died in the early hours of yesterday after a prolonged illness at a private hospital in the city.

The mourning period, which commenced today, is in line with the age-old tradition of the ancient city, reports The Nation.

Following the conclusion of the mourning period, members of the Olubadan-in-Council are expected to begin the traditional process of selecting and installing a new Olubadan.

According to the established succession hierarchy, the Otun Olubadan of Ibadanland, Oba Rasidi Ladoja, is next in line to ascend the throne.

His nomination will be made by the Balogun Olubadan, Oba Tajudeen Ajibola, and seconded by the Osi Olubadan, Oba Eddy Oyewole, during a yet-to-be-convened meeting at the new Olubadan palace in Oke-Aremo, Ibadan North Local Government Area.

Oba Ladoja, who was reportedly out of town when news of Oba Olakulehin’s death broke, is expected to return to Ibadan next week to begin the formal traditional process.

A source confirmed that several prominent individuals have been reaching out to condole with him on the monarch’s passing.
